PURPOSE:To suppress the increase in induced current in a normal superconducting wirings and to prevent the occurrence of normal conduction transition, by making the resistance value of a protective resistor, which is connected to another magnetically coupled normal superconducting winding, higher than an ordinary value, when the normal conduction transition occurs in the seperconducting winding. CONSTITUTION:Two superconducting windings C1 and C2 are magnetically coupled through mutual inductance M. An ordinary protective resistor R1 and an auxiliary protective resistor R1' are connected in series across both ends of the first superconducting winding C1. A contactor B1' is connected to the R1' in parallel. The B1' is interlocked with a breaker B1. When normal conduction transition is detected in the first superconducting winding C1, the B1 is turned OFF and the B1' is turned ON. Therefore, a state, in which only the R1 is connected to the C1, is obtained. At this time, a voltage is induced in the second superconducting winding C2 through the mutual inductance M and current is increased. Since R2' is connected to R2 as a protective resistor for the C2 in series, the increase in current is suppressed in comparison with the case, in which only the R2 is used. Thus the occurrence of the normal conduction transition in the C2 can be prevented. |
